Antxieta House (Azpeitia)

It is located in the historic centre of Azpeitia, next to the Parish Church of San Sebastián de Soreasu.

It was built by Juan de Antxieta, musician of the Catholic Monarchs, circa 1507. The most prominent building is the façade, a prototype of Mudejar style. It is built in several stages, alternating the building materials, stone on the ground floor and brick for the rest.

Today it is a residence for disabled persons ATZEGI.
